Metabolomics Analyst Job Description and Career Detail

Metabolomics Analyst roles focus on interpreting complex metabolic data using advanced mass spectrometry and NMR spectroscopy techniques to identify biomarkers and metabolic pathways. Proficiency in bioinformatics tools such as MetaboAnalyst and strong statistical analysis skills using R or Python are essential for meaningful data integration and visualization. Experience in designing experiments, sample preparation, and collaborating with multi-disciplinary teams enhances the accuracy and application of metabolomic profiling in drug discovery, clinical research, and personalized medicine.

Qualification

A Metabolomics Analyst must possess a strong foundation in biochemistry, analytical chemistry, and mass spectrometry techniques. Proficiency in data analysis software such as MetaboAnalyst, XCMS, and statistical tools like R or Python is essential for interpreting complex metabolomic datasets. A degree in biochemistry, molecular biology, or a related field along with experience in chromatography and MS instrumentation is highly valued.

Responsibility

Metabolomics Analysts are responsible for designing and executing experiments to analyze metabolites using advanced techniques like mass spectrometry and nuclear magnetic resonance spectroscopy. They interpret complex biochemical data to identify metabolic changes and biomarkers associated with diseases or drug treatments. Ensuring data quality, maintaining laboratory instruments, and collaborating with cross-functional teams for research and development are key responsibilities in this role.

Challenge

A Metabolomics Analyst likely faces challenges in managing and interpreting complex datasets generated from advanced analytical techniques such as mass spectrometry and NMR spectroscopy. Ensuring accuracy and reproducibility in metabolite identification and quantification might require extensive troubleshooting and method development. The evolving landscape of bioinformatics tools could also demand continuous learning to effectively integrate metabolomic data with other omics layers for comprehensive biological insights.

Multivariate Statistical Analysis

A Metabolomics Analyst specializing in multivariate statistical analysis interprets complex metabolomic data sets using techniques such as PCA, PLS-DA, and OPLS to identify biomarkers and metabolic pathways. Expertise in software tools like SIMCA, MetaboAnalyst, and R enhances the capacity to analyze high-dimensional data from mass spectrometry and NMR spectroscopy. This role demands proficiency in data preprocessing, normalization, and validation to ensure robust and reproducible biological insights in metabolomics research.
